Code of Arkansas Rules Title 26 — Taxation
26 CAR § 211-305
Access
# (a) Office staff
(a) Office staff.
(1) It is understood that elected officials and office staff will view, edit, add, and delete records from the county computer system in the normal course of their work.
(2) Specific rights and privileges will be granted to do so in accordance with this document and published office policies.
(3) Violation of this and additional policies may result in a user losing access to the computer system.
# (b) Contractors
(b) Contractors.
(1) It is understood that contractors may from time to time be required to access the county computer system in the performance of their contracted work.
(2) Access to the county computer system by the contractor shall be described in the agreement with respect to:
(A) Connected devices;
(B) Security level;
(C) Timing;
(D) Duties;
(E) Privileges;
(F) Access methods; and
(G) Schedules.
(3) Records may be added, edited, and deleted by the contractor in accordance with requirements and restrictions of the governing agreement between the county and the contractor.
# (c) Public users
(c) Public users.
(1) It is understood that public users may, in the course of reviewing county records, use the county computer system.
(2) Records may not be added, edited, or deleted by any public user.
(3) The desktop, network, and application security collectively shall prevent any record modification by a public user.
(4)(A) Public users shall not introduce foreign media such as floppy disks, CDs, DVDs, USB memory devices, or any other media to the county system.
(B) This practice shall be prohibited by published policy and system configuration.
(5)(A) The county may provide blank media for the purpose of transferring files from the computer system for public consumption.
(B) Blank media should be approved in advance by the system administrator.
